Thanks to a friend, I discovered Turboweekend, a Danish group, which has released in March 2009 his second album "Ghost of a Chance". It consists of 11 tracks, including the discovery of the moment "Something or Nothing", a sublime track we will review in the following article. The Danish trio offers an album that mixes subtly electronic music and rock. Its particularity: a rock band without guitars! It has been nominated for the Best Newcomer of the Year 2009 at two of the biggest Danish award shows, P3 Gold and Zulu Awards.
This second album that was released under Mermaid Recording has been recorded in their studio in Copenhagen and shows all the talent of this trio notably the Danish voice of Silas Bjerregaard. He is accompanied on bass by Morten Køie and Martin Petersen on drums and on some productions of Anders Møller as a singer and synth player. It follows their first opus "Night Shift" that mixed pop and electronic music. The group is for example in the tradition of The Whitest Boy Alive. These Danish guys offer tracks that are mainly produced around a duo bass drums and synthesizers.
On this album, apart from the title we review there is the massive "Up with the Smoke - Down with the Ash" which takes us into a world of minimalist and psychedelic groove. It blows our heart with a trendy musical performance. There are also the excellent "After hours" and "Erase me" tracks that are in a funkier atmosphere with a voice close to an Uffie one. It is mainly these pieces that have an electro influence, the other are efficient too but not really dancefloor.
More precisely, for the track "Something or Nothing", it is a track that uses a combination of both rock and electronic elements and samples. The voice is perfect to pair with a very rhythmic dancefloor melody, musically accessible, like some Martin Solveig productions. It is a really exiting piece of music.

Turboweekend “Ghost of a chance” album tracklisting:
01. Turboweekend - Trouble Is
02. Turboweekend - Something or Nothing
03. Turboweekend - Sweet Jezebel
04. Turboweekend - Holiday
05. Turboweekend - Colors
06. Turboweekend - Up With the Smoke - Down With the Ash
07. Turboweekend - After Hours
08. Turboweekend - Erase myself
09. Turboweekend - Your Body Free From Mine
10. Turboweekend - Good Morning Moon
11. Turboweekend - Almost There
